          "ResourceName": "GOES 8 Triaxial Fluxgate Magnetometer (FGM), Magnetic Field and Ephemeris, Multiple Coordinate Systems, 1.0 min Data",
          "ReleaseDate": "2021-04-27T17:52:57Z",
          "Description": "The NOAA Geostationary Operational Environment Satellite (GOES) key parameters.  This data is a subset of the data available from the GOES Space Environment Monitor (SEM) instruments.  It contains vector magnetic field in three coordinate systems:\r\n\r\n* Spacecraft P,E,N\r\n* GSM X,Y,Z\r\n* GSE X,Y,Z\r\n\r\nSpacecraft magnetic field is defined as:\r\n\r\n* P perpendicular to the spacecraft orbital plane or parallel to the spin axis of the Earth in the case of a 0° inclination orbit\r\n* E perpendicular to P and directed earthward\r\n* N perpendicular to both P and E and directed eastward",
